HVAC Leak Water Removal Cost In Fruitville, FL

The cost of HVAC leak water removal in Fruitville, FL, can vary based on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Don’t wait until the damage is too extensive act now to reduce costs and ensure a safe living environment for your family.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,500 The severity of the leak and the size of the affected area.
Water Extraction $1,000 – $5,000 The amount of water extracted and the equipment required.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,500 – $6,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ment required.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ment required.

Q: How long does it take to complete the drying process?

A: The drying process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the equipment required. Our team will work with you to create a customized drying plan that meets your needs and ensures a safe living environment for your family.
